Output 172a651b51cfd5c8e0a785647631cf97e52cda604edd255942e6d3a42f2cd2e8: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40ab2c8f6bc62b0c9dad7ed5bcf4a8f5bf2c3c43 OP_EQUAL
address
37axECkGLF5hJTBu8QxeTMuGCcA4ARTA7S
transaction
172a651b51cfd5c8e0a785647631cf97e52cda604edd255942e6d3a42f2cd2e8
confirmations
163755
spent
true